Am I eligible for a GLP-1 in Frontier?

Most providers require a BMI of 30 or higher, or 27+ with a weight-related condition such as type 2 diabetes, high blood pressure or high cholesterol. Check your BMI in seconds:

  • BMI 30+ — generally eligible
  • BMI 27–29 with a comorbidity — often eligible
  • A licensed North Dakota provider confirms in minutes

Semaglutide vs. tirzepatide & the GLP-1 options

Brand-name and compounded options available to Frontier patients

ShotMoleculeApproved forFrequencyTypical price
Ozempic Semaglutide Type 2 diabetes (off-label weight loss) Once weekly $950–$1,350/mo
Wegovy Semaglutide Chronic weight management Once weekly $1,300–$1,400/mo
Mounjaro Tirzepatide Type 2 diabetes (off-label weight loss) Once weekly $1,000–$1,200/mo
Zepbound Tirzepatide Chronic weight management Once weekly $1,000–$1,060/mo
Compounded Semaglutide / Tirzepatide Cash-pay telehealth option Once weekly $199–$499/mo

Prices are typical U.S. cash-pay ranges without insurance; manufacturer savings cards and coverage can lower brand-name costs significantly.

What to expect: dosing & side effects

GLP-1 medications are given as a once-weekly subcutaneous injection, starting at a low dose that your provider increases gradually over several weeks to limit side effects. Most Frontier patients self-inject at home after a short demonstration.

The most common side effects are nausea, diarrhea, constipation, decreased appetite and mild injection-site reactions — usually mild and fading over the first few weeks. Rare but serious risks include pancreatitis, gallbladder issues and thyroid concerns; GLP-1s should not be used by people with a personal or family history of medullary thyroid carcinoma or MEN 2. Your provider reviews your full history before prescribing.

In clinical trials, semaglutide patients lost about 15% of body weight and tirzepatide patients up to 22.5% over roughly 68–72 weeks on the highest dose. For a 200-pound person that is roughly 30–45 pounds. Results in Frontier vary with diet, activity and starting weight.
